|
|
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
У меня такая база: Таблица1 - Сотрудники, Таблица2 - Заказчики, Таблица3 - Адреса Заказчиков. Я хотел сделать такие формы: Начальная - в ней выпадающий список где выбирается определенный Сотрудник, ниже выпадающий список где выбирается Город (из таблицы Адреса) и ниже кнопка, которая открывает другую форму, в которой наверху выпадающий список Заказчиков и ниже идут данные о Заказчике (Таблица Заказчики) и его адресные данные (Таблица Адреса). Таблицы я вроде связал, но я плохо разбираюсь в Access (как чайник) и не могу связать выбор в выпадающих списках с последующими данными. Например: Если я выбрал в выпадающем списке определенного Сотрудника, то в выпадающим списке Города должны быть только те Города, которые относятся к этому Сотруднику, далее, выбрав город и нажав на кнопку нужно, чтобы в следующей форме, в выпадающем списке Заказчики были только Заказчики этого сотрудника и этого города Помогите пожалуйста 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.04.2003, 09:53 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
А как такой вариант? Создать форму без источника данных - назвать напр. "Главная" и добавить в нее 4 субформы - "Сотрудники", "ГородаСотрудника", "Заказчики", "АдресаЗаказчиков" - источники данных для субформ, кроме первой (построитель в поле "данные" свойств формы): Код: plaintext Код: plaintext 1. 2.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.04.2003, 10:39 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
Я очень плохо в этом разбираюсь. Вот слово Построитель так и писать в поле Данные? И где именно? А событие Текущая запись - это где такое?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.04.2003, 14:10 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
Ой, извините за глупые вопросы. Разобрался. Но так, как я понял получаются все данные в одной форме? Я хотел, что бы в начальной задавались параметры фильтрации (Сотрудник, Город) и после нажатия кнопки выскакивала вторая форма с выбором Заказчиков. Так можно как-нибудь сделать? и еще я хочу вместо форм все это сделать в HTML Как быть!!!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.04.2003, 15:14 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
При открытии задавай Record Sourse новой форме 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.04.2003, 15:20 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
Создай ни с чем ни связанную форму, на ней размести поля-со-списками (Сотрудник, Город), задай им соотвесвтующие источники. Создай подчиненую форму (ни с чем опять же не связанную), этой подчиненой пропиши источник тот набор записей к-ый ты хочешь получить, а по полям (Сотрудник, Город) введи условие отбора (типа Forms("ИмяГлавнойФормы")("ИмяПоляСотруника") На событие обновления полей Сотрудник и Город сделай обноление источника подчиненой.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.04.2003, 15:30 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
При открытии формы прописать Record Sourse. А где именно это прописывается?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.04.2003, 16:36 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
на кнопке открывающей новую форму... на событии OnClick после строчки DoCmd.OpenForm FormName написать Forms!FormName.RecordSource = "Тело запроса" 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.04.2003, 17:06 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
Если в HTML, то может сразу на странице доступа к данным экспериментировать?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.04.2003, 17:45 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
Да! Хотелось бы прямо со странички ХТМЛ сразу поэксперементировать. Только как?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.04.2003, 23:15 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
Sfagnum, я написал как ты сказал, а он пишет при открытии формы "Не существует источник записей "Тело запроса" 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.04.2003, 09:36 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
Senin Viktor писал "На событие обновления полей Сотрудник и Город сделай обноление источника подчиненой" Вот не подскажите как это делается. Сами формы у меня есть и делать другие не хочется, я бы просто прописал это обновление во всех полях, которые зависят от выпадающих списков 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.04.2003, 10:14 |
|
||
|
Помогите разобраться с выпадающими списками
|
|||
|---|---|---|---|
|
#18+
Код: plaintext 1. 2. 3.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.04.2003, 10:24 |
|
||
|
|

start [/forum/topic.php?fid=45&gotonew=1&tid=1681725]: |
0ms |
get settings: |
8ms |
get forum list: |
22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
46ms |
get topic data: |
13ms |
get first new msg: |
6ms |
get forum data: |
3ms |
get page messages: |
52ms |
get tp. blocked users: |
1ms |
| others: | 213ms |
| total: | 370ms |

| 0 / 0 |
